Higuey vs Zaragoza, Aragon Climate & Distance Between

Spain flag
  • The distance between Higuey, Dominican Republic and Zaragoza, Aragon, Spain is approximately 6,812 km or 4,233 mi.
  • To reach Higuey in this distance one would set out from Zaragoza, Aragon bearing 269.9° or W and follow the great circles arc to approach Higuey bearing 232° or SW .
  • Higuey has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Zaragoza, Aragon has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k).
  • Higuey is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Zaragoza, Aragon is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 11.7 °C (21.1°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 14.8 °C (26.6°F) less in Higuey.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1109.2 mm (43.7 in) more which is equivalent to 1109.2 l/m² (27.22 US gal/ft²) or 11,092,000 l/ha (1,185,808 US gal/ac) more. About 4 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.6° higher in Higuey than in Zaragoza, Aragon.
